In Rajasthan, five lakh cheap houses will be constructed for urban poor under the affordable housing policy. This was announced by Chief Minister Ashok Gehlot while laying the foundation stone of “Sahbhagita Awas Yojna” near Jaipur on Friday. He said that 21 such housing schemes will be developed across the state on the PPP model. The cost of the house to be allotted to the urban poor under this scheme will be just two lakh 40 thousand rupees
